Output 34c8f96e6da91a3a5645f5418becf04bdc89c94c8c2b08cc4861bec6220fc714:12

value
202333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 295a646d73b96284ba9c3f3f8a30be85bd25df3c OP_EQUAL
address
35TfuyY5CuoeMReGU86k81Sp75t8RzgWVT
transaction
34c8f96e6da91a3a5645f5418becf04bdc89c94c8c2b08cc4861bec6220fc714
confirmations
20870
spent
true